Common Challenges in PTO Ticket Sales
Here are some typical issues that PTO leaders encounter:
- Lack of organization: Without a structured approach, it’s easy to overlook vital details like ticket pricing, deadlines, and distribution methods.
- Poor communication: Failing to effectively promote your event can lead to low attendance, ultimately diminishing fundraising potential.
- Time-consuming processes: Manual ticket sales can be tedious, causing delays and frustration among volunteers and attendees.
PTO Ticket Sales Checklist: Steps to Success
To overcome these challenges, it’s essential to implement a comprehensive PTO ticket sales checklist. Here’s a step-by-step guide to ensure your ticket sales run smoothly:
1. Define Your Event
Start by clarifying the purpose of your event. Is it a fundraiser, a school carnival, or a community gathering? Understanding the goal will help you determine ticket pricing and sales strategies.
2. Set a Budget
Establish a clear budget, factoring in expenses such as venue, entertainment, and refreshments. This will guide your ticket pricing and fundraising goals.
3. Choose a Ticketing Method
Decide whether you’ll use physical tickets, online sales, or a combination of both. Online sales can streamline the process and allow for easier tracking.
4. Create a Marketing Plan
Promote your event through newsletters, social media, and flyers. Engaging visuals and clear messaging can significantly boost ticket sales.
5. Implement a Sales Strategy
Determine how you will sell tickets. Options include:
- Direct sales at school events
- Online platforms to facilitate purchases
- Collaboration with local businesses to sell tickets
6. Track Sales Efficiently
Monitoring ticket sales is crucial for knowing how many attendees to expect. Consider using a digital platform that allows for real-time tracking.
7. Prepare for the Event
Ensure everything is in place, from ticket collection to event logistics. Have a plan for managing attendees and volunteers on the event day.
8. Follow Up After the Event
Thank your attendees, share event highlights, and report on the funds raised. This builds goodwill and encourages participation in future events.
